In a surprising turn of events, five Denny's locations in the Finger Lakes region of New York have closed their doors. The affected restaurants include those in Victor, Henrietta, and Canandaigua.

The Denny's on Eastern Boulevard in Canandaigua has shut down, and the signage from the location has been removed. This closure is part of a broader shutdown involving the regional Denny's chain. Notices were placed on the doors of the closed Canandaigua Denny's.

Franchise owner Feast American Diners cited ongoing fallout from the COVID-19 pandemic as the reason behind the closures. The company, which has been keeping residents informed for more than two decades, stated that many restaurants, including Denny's franchises, faced operational and financial challenges during the pandemic. These challenges often led to permanent or temporary closures in certain regions.

The closures highlight shifting business conditions in the area. This is not the first time the Canandaigua Denny's location has shut down.
